National Cancer Awareness Day was established to raise awareness for the early detection of cancer — the second leading cause of death globally, responsible for 9.6 million deaths annually — and to promote screening, prevention, and support for patients and caregivers. National Bison Day is observed on the first Saturday of November to celebrate the American bison — designated the national mammal of the United States in 2016 after its population rebounded from fewer than 1,000 animals in the 1880s to more than 500,000 today. Hug a Bear Day was established to celebrate the teddy bear — named after President Theodore Roosevelt’s 1902 refusal to shoot a bear that had been tied to a tree, which inspired a toy design that became one of the most beloved children’s companions in history. National Canine Lymphoma Awareness Day was established to raise awareness for lymphoma in dogs — the third most common canine cancer, affecting an estimated 20 to 100 per 100,000 dogs annually.
